1. 程式人生 > >MAC Iterm2 配置過程中,問題記錄

MAC Iterm2 配置過程中,問題記錄

如題:

配置方式按照網上統一配置,具體可參照https://blog.csdn.net/tterminator/article/details/79736390,其中oh-my-zsh安裝可按照文章中所述,也可直接命令列安裝,也可直接參照https://www.jianshu.com/p/7de00c73a2bb進行

安裝過程中遇到的問題:

問題一:

很多部落格中提及特殊字型配置時,在iTerm2的Preferences——Profiles——Text中同時將Regular Font和Non—ASCII Font設定為Meslo LG M DZ Regular for Powerline,然而並沒有找到該字型

解決方式:

下載並安裝Powerline字型

1)git clone https://github.com/powerline/fonts.git

2)cd fonts

3)./install.sh

此時便可在iterm2中找到對應的字型

問題二:

按照教程配置好後,退出重新進入,配置的顏色和樣式都沒有了

解決方式:

1. 在oh-my-zsh安裝目錄,檢視是否有遺留的.zshrc相關的配置,如果有刪除,重新進入即可(以我的安裝目錄為例,即看家目錄下有沒有多餘的相關的配置檔案)

由於我安裝了兩遍on-my-zsh,使用原始程式碼安裝了一次,解除安裝後又直接安裝了一次,網上有說法是如果有多個相關的配置時,其在初始化讀取配置時,會失敗,讀取不到配置,即配置不生效

問題三:

安裝完git 後,直接執行git clone 還是提示安裝xcode,但是普通的terminal下面執行git --version是正常的,再不想安裝xcode,且沒有安裝xcode 命令工具的情況下,按照如下解決:

解決方式:

1. 命令列執行 PATH=/usr/local/git/bin:$PATH

這是基於我的git安裝路徑的,如果時直接用dmg安裝的,基本都是在這個路徑,如果不是請修改為自己的git 安裝路徑

問題四:

安裝sz,rz時,由於不想使用homebrew安裝sz,rz, 所以找了另外一種安裝方式,具體請參加部落格https://segmentfault.com/a/1190000010138405

再該部落格最後安裝lrzsz 時,按照步驟執行時,提示必須安裝Xcode,此時並沒有找到make ,gcc等的安裝包,所以選擇安裝xcode命令工具,並非全部的xcode

解決方式:

1. 命令列執行 xcode-select --install (該命令在mac 10.10+後才可直接執行,即毋需安裝xcode,即可直接安裝命令列工具)

按照要求安裝完成後,可在/Library/Developer/CommandLineTools/usr/bin中檢視已安裝的工具,此時發現make,gcc等均已安裝,即可按照上述部落格中,最後安裝lrzsz,需要注意,執行make install 時,請使用sudo make install

問題五:

上述安裝的szrz,在pdk上使用正常,在docker上使用異常,所以使用brew重新安裝,其會提示先刪除已安裝的,刪除完成後,出現錯誤,Homebrew: Could not symlink, /usr/local/bin is not writable

解決方式:

 

即執行 sudo chown -R  `whoami`:admin /usr/local/bin,,,,可根據錯誤提示更換不同的路徑

具體參照連結:https://stackoverflow.com/questions/26647412/homebrew-could-not-symlink-usr-local-bin-is-not-writable